Glory Lost

Rate this book
Sadie, sixteen, witnesses her parents' murders at the hands of Confederate Raiders. Driven by revenge, she dresses like a man and joins the Union Army as a prestigious Sharpshooter attached to Sherman's Army. She finds love from a very unexpected source. and runs from a man who is trying to steal her land and who has vowed to either bed her or kill her.

About the author

Joyce Shaughnessy

12 books52 followers
Joyce recently lost her husband and has moved from Midland, Texas to Humble, Texas to be close to family. She has two daughters and four granddaughters, She is also close to her sister, Gay, who lives five minutes away and her other sister, La Jean, who lives in Beaumont, Texas.
Her latest book, "Glory Lost," was released on 08/01/2022 by Black Opal Books. It is about a young girl who enlists in the Union Army, is a Sharpshooter, and joins Sherman through Atlanta and his March to the Sea.
She has self-published five books. The first three are historical fiction in a series titled "The Pearl of the Orient." The books are "A Healing Place," "Blessed Are the Merciful," and "The Unsurrendered."
She has also self-published a children's book, "Mr Grumpy Lizard Meets the Giggling Girls."
She has participated in one round robin novel, "Gryffon Master, Curse of the Lich King," and three anthologies, "Lava Storm," "Dangerous Days," and "World of Pirates."
She has also become a Certified Copy Editor and has experience with two anthologies and three novels as well as participating in critique groups for the last six years.
